Kallisti
Grape variety: Assyrtiko
Boutari Kallisti is the first fumé wine to be crafted in Greece. Its name literally translates from Greek to the fairest, and was inspired by Santorini’s ancient name. This is Boutari’s barrel-fermented version of the Santorini A.O.C.
The vineyard of Santorini is one of the oldest in Greece (300 years old). The vines are not grafted on American rootstocks because phylloxera (vine louse) has never “attacked” the island.
